Temecula vs Murrieta
Side-by-side comparison
How does Temecula, CA compare to Murrieta, CA? Temecula has a population of 110,404 with a median household income of $117,840, while Murrieta has 111,621 residents and a median income of $109,780.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Temecula, CA | Murrieta, CA |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 110,404 | 111,621 | -1.1% |
| Median Age | 36.3 | 36 | +0.8% |
| Foreign Born % | 16.6% | 15.7% | +5.7% |
| Metric | Temecula | Murrieta |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$117,840 | $109,780 | +7.3% |
| Unemployment | 5.7% | 7.1% | -19.7% |
| Poverty Rate | 7.4% | 5.9% | +25.4% |
| Bachelor's+ | 39.2% | 31.8% | +23.3% |
| Metric | Temecula | Murrieta |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$640,400 | $606,900 | +5.5% |
| Median Rent | $2297/mo | $2330/mo | -1.4% |
| Housing Units | 36,866 | 37,306 | -1.2% |
